Why Search Optimisation Now Means More Than Google Rankings

July 26, 2026

More people are starting a search in ChatGPT, Perplexity, or Google’s AI Overviews instead of a traditional results page — and none of those tools rank a page the way a classic search algorithm does. They summarise, cite, and recommend, which means the businesses that show up in those answers aren’t necessarily the ones that would have ranked highest in a normal search a year ago.

That shift doesn’t call for a brand new, separately-branded discipline bolted onto a website. It calls for the same core work, extended. Structuring content so it’s genuinely useful, clearly written, and easy for a machine to parse and trust is still SEO’s job — it’s just that the “machine” reading it now includes AI systems generating answers, not only search engines generating a results page.

That’s why it’s sold as one combined capability — SEO / GEO Content — rather than a separately-invented service for the AI half. Deeper work here means structuring and writing content so it holds up in both a traditional search result and an AI-generated answer, not choosing one over the other.
